Tragic Murder Case Unfolds in Albany, Georgia

In a heartbreaking turn of events, a 35-year-old cold case involving the death of a young child has resurfaced in Albany, Georgia. Evelyn Odom and Ulyster Sanders have been charged with murder in connection to the tragic demise of their 5-year-old daughter, Kenyatta “Keke” Odom, formerly known as Baby Jane Doe.

The Discovery of Baby Jane Doe

The harrowing discovery of Baby Jane Doe’s remains, encased in a television cabinet filled with concrete, sent shockwaves through the community. For decades, the child’s identity remained a mystery until a crucial clue found in an Albany Herald newspaper linked the case to the city.

The Legal Proceedings

Following the recent arrest of Evelyn Odom and Ulyster Sanders, the legal process has begun to unfold. A bond hearing was held on June 11, where the judge refrained from making a ruling. The defendants will now have to await a rescheduled bond hearing and trial date.

Evelyn Odom’s attorney has filed a plea of not guilty on her behalf, indicating her intention to fight the charges laid against her. Meanwhile, Ulyster Sanders’ legal team has sought a certificate of review, with updates on his case pending.
